Kyle Long booted from Bears practice for fighting multiple times
Sporting News,Yahoo7 3 hours ago
Kyle Long woke up on the wrong side of the bed on Monday.
The Bears left guard was kicked out of practice for fighting multiple times. The incidents were with both offensive and defensive players and during both individual and team drills, according to ESPN.com.
"There's a certain standard we have and it's something we weren't very pleased with," Bears coach John Fox said. "I haven't had a chance to visit with him yet, but it's something that we'll handle it internally."
Long has been sidelined since November when he tore a ligament in his right ankle against the Buccaneers. The team has been working with him to increase his practice and workout time as he recovers.

As to why Long got into several fights, Fox didn't offer any information nor did he try to dive into the issue.
"I really can't answer that at this point, I'm sure obviously there was some frustration — again, that's not how we operate," Fox said. "I didn't really see everything, just know that there was a disturbance and we don't need that. That's why he left the field."
